πŸ“ Brief Summary ​

Lufthansa cuts 20,000 short-haul summer flights due to soaring jet fuel prices, which have doubled since the US-Israel conflict with Iran disrupted Middle East production and transport. Other airlines...

πŸ” Market Background ​

The Gulf region supplies about 50% of Europe's aviation fuel imports, with the Strait of Hormuz effectively closed by Iran amid US-Israeli attacks.

πŸ’‘ Expert Opinion ​

The surge in jet fuel costs, exacerbated by geopolitical tensions in the Gulf, is directly squeezing airline margins, forcing capacity cuts that will likely persist. Travelers should brace for higher ticket prices and further flight cancellations as the conflict continues to disrupt fuel supply chains.
